Перейти к основному содержанию

Documentation Index

Fetch the complete documentation index at: https://apidoc.cometapi.com/llms.txt

Use this file to discover all available pages before exploring further.

BuildShip — это low-code визуальный конструктор backend. Используйте узел сообщества CometAPI Text Generator, чтобы добавить AI-генерацию текста в любой workflow.

Предварительные требования

1

Получите API-ключ CometAPI

Войдите в консоль CometAPI. Нажмите Add API Key и скопируйте свой ключ <COMETAPI_KEY>.
Панель CometAPI с кнопкой Add API Key
Детали API-ключа CometAPI с base URL
2

Создайте workflow с триггером REST API

  1. В панели BuildShip нажмите Create a new workflow → From Scratch.
  2. На холсте нажмите Add Trigger и выберите REST API. Это создаст вызываемый endpoint для workflow.
3

Добавьте узел CometAPI Text Generator

  1. Под триггером REST API нажмите + Add a new step.
  2. В поле поиска библиотеки узлов введите cometapi.
  3. В списке Community выберите CometAPI Text Generator.
Библиотека узлов BuildShip с CometAPI Text Generator в результатах поиска
Узел CometAPI Text Generator добавлен на холст
4

Свяжите интеграцию CometAPI

На этом шаге узлу указывается, какую систему управления ключами использовать.
  1. Нажмите на узел, чтобы открыть Node Editor справа.
  2. Переключитесь на вкладку Settings.
  3. В разделе Key-based Integration откройте выпадающий список и выберите CometAPI.
  4. Нажмите синюю кнопку Save в правом верхнем углу.
Вкладка Settings в Node Editor, где Key-based Integration установлена в CometAPI
5

Добавьте API-ключ в узел

  1. В Node Editor переключитесь на вкладку Inputs (или нажмите прямо на узел).
  2. Нажмите на значок ключа 🔑 в правом верхнем углу узла, чтобы открыть выпадающее меню ключей.
  3. Выберите + Bring your own Key.
  4. Введите Key ID (например, cometapi-key-1) и вставьте свой ключ <COMETAPI_KEY> в поле Value.
  5. Нажмите Save.
Диалог управления ключами с заполненными полями Key ID и Value
Узел с успешно привязанным ключом
6

Настройте входные параметры

На вкладке Inputs узла:
  • Instructions (необязательно): задайте системную роль, например You are a productivity assistant.
  • Prompt: нажмите значок </>, затем выберите Trigger → Body → prompt, чтобы сопоставить входящее тело запроса.
  • Advanced → Model: введите актуальный model ID, который хотите использовать.
Узел CometAPI с настроенными Instructions, Prompt и Model
7

Добавьте узел Return Response и протестируйте

  1. Под узлом CometAPI нажмите + Add a new step и выберите Return Response.
  2. В поле Body нажмите </> и выберите переменную response из узла CometAPI Text Generator.
  3. Нажмите Test в правом верхнем углу, выберите формат входных данных JSON и отправьте:
{
  "prompt": "hi"
}
  1. Успешный ответ в панели Result подтверждает, что workflow работает.
Панель тестирования BuildShip с успешным ответом CometAPI
Если вызов завершается ошибкой, проверьте API-ключ и убедитесь, что в Key-based Integration выбрано CometAPI, или обратитесь в поддержку CometAPI.
Шаг Key-based Integration (связывание узла с CometAPI) обязателен — если его пропустить, возникнут ошибки аутентификации, даже если API-ключ указан верно.